(For what it's worth, "frenulum" is the general term for a little tag of skin that connects something (usually a larger fold) to the underlying structure. There is one common place for a frenulum in the genitalia (male and female), but you can also feel one on the underside of your upper lip, in the middle up under where your nose is. Also, there is often one in a similar place inside the lower lip.)
